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0714 3951982 5728 22367674963 36617667
00533527548 81293310743
00533527548 81293310743
95986523835 93147693807 19 672470160
All about undefined
Interested in learning more?
00533527548 81293310743
95986523835 93147693807 19 672470160
See more
877787 53187
2281 0886 77 291781259
See more
087 9115985 8632053965
857666 53603 57372561841
See more